The Whitehorse – Just Dance monthly events are put on by Steve Potter as an outlet for his joint passions of dancing, DJaying and community. Hailing from the United Kingdom, he spent most of the ’90s running record labels, promoting events and producing music in Birmingham, England. Now a family man, he doesn’t have the time to go out all night – but isn’t ready to hang up his dancing shoes just yet. He brings this deep love and knowledge of all kinds of music (house/reggae/’80s/disco/hip-hop) to Just Dance. An acupuncturist by day, he also aims to combine the dance night with his interest in meditation and bodywork to create an event that is fun, meditative and healing.
